But For Him

Rejoice in the Lord and His tender care,
 For us He died on the Cross;
To Calv’ry He went, our sins all to bear,
 For us He suffered such loss.

In thinking of all that we have achieved,
 How proud of ourselves we grow;
We must be careful lest we be deceived
 For He made it all we know.
No one can erase the guilt of his sin
 Without the Old Rugged Cross;
“There is none righteous…” is true of all men,
 For us He suffered such loss.
The Lord saw our plight and came to our aid,
 While we were yet sinners, friend;
And with His own blood for our sins He paid
 On none else may we depend.
Despised and rejected at ev’ry turn,
 On Him the Lord laid our sin;
The way to heaven from Him we may learn:
 The new life will you begin?
We often think not of what He has done,
 As we our busy lives live;
We seem to forget He’s God’s Precious Son:
 What more could anyone give?

Rejoice in the Lord and His tender care,
 For us He died on the Cross;
To Calv’ry He went, our sins all to bear,
 For us He suffered such loss.

H. L. Gradowith
